Favorite Anime of 2009 Survey- Polls Open!
Posted on Friday, January 29th 2010 by AJtheFourth



The time has come today, so hopefully you all had a chance to think long and hard about what anime tickled your fancy in the year 2009. That's right, for the fourth straight year, Anime-Source is pleased to announce that the polls are open for the annual Favorite Anime of the Year Survey! Forge on ahead for details and voting rules.

The Ins and Outs of the Democratic Process:

1. Head on over to the Anime Reviews Database or go to the 2009 Anime List.

2. Click on the series link to view the database synopsis/review page.

3. Click on the bright yellow link that says, 'Vote for top anime of 2009.'

4. You will be prompted to write a short blurb about what you liked about that particular anime. Remember that the top comments get featured for everyone to read! This screen will also remind you of the rules. Once you're finished writing an amazing comment, hit 'send' and this will make your vote final.

5. The next screen will thank you and show you how many votes you have left. Lather, rinse, and repeat until all of your votes are entered.


Rules and Regulations:

*As it has been with previous surveys, members are allowed five votes, non-members are allowed three votes. Make sure you log in before voting to get your maximum number of votes!

*Remember that votes are weighted, so the anime in your number one slot will receive more points than the anime in your number five slot. These are factored into the final tally. You can re-order your votes from the submission screen after you click on an anime to vote for.

*It goes without saying that you shouldn't try to cheat by using multiple computers, etc. You can vote for each anime only once, so vote wisely, and choose your order wisely.

*Any anime series/movie/OVA that began from January 1st 2009 to December 31st 2009 is eligible for this survey. *The polls are open from now until February 20th. This gives you some time, not only to pick and choose what anime were truly your favorites, but also gives you a chance to finish up a series or two if you need to.
